Hey guys, I'm at my wit's end here. I'm trying to get my PS4/3 connected to the internet and I don't know what to do.
I recently moved and my source for internet is Wifi. There is NO chance of me using ethernet to the modem/router, I have to go Wifi. My laptop, which runs Linux Mint 18 Cinnamon x64, can get a decent signal.
However, none of my other machines can. So I decided to use my laptop as a bridge. I can run a standard CAT5E ethernet cable to an 8-port unmanaged Netgear switch (GS108 model) and my desktop PC gets internet that way. I was able to download World of Warcraft no problem.
However, the same cannot be said for my Sony consoles. No matter what I do, I can't do the same.
I have tried the following
1) Connect both consoles to Netgear switch
2) Connect consoles to laptop using regular ethernet cable
3) Connect consoles to laptop using crossover ethernet cable.
I'm not sure if I have to manually set up the settings PS4 side when I try the crossover cable. When I do that, it defaults to highlighting the "Manual" option instead of "Automatic" when it asks for IP settings, but I don't know what to put in there. If I go full automatic for every option PS4 side, it fails at the Obtain IP address stage.
